To use this chart: Read up from the ambient temper-
ature to the curve, and across to find a correction fac-
tor. Multiply the breaker rating by the correction fac-
tor to determine the compensated rating. Calculate
the overloads in terms of the compensated rating to
use the published trip curve.
Do not use these devices outside their specified
operating temperature ranges.

Electrical Data @ 25°C
Calibration: Will continuously carry 100% of rating.
may trip between 101% and 134%, but
must trip at 135% of rating within one hour at +25°C.
Dielectric Strength: Over 1,500 volts RMS.
Maximum Operating Voltages: 32VDC; 250VAC, 50/60 Hz.
Interrupt Capacity: 1,000 amps at 250VAC, 50/60 Hz. and 32VDC in
accordance with UL standard 1077.
Mechanical/Environmental Data
Termination: 250” (6.35mm) quick connects. Soldering to terminals is
not recommended.
Mounting: Snaps into panel from front. See Recommended
Panel Cutouts.
Approximate Weight: 0.35 oz. (10g).
Resettable Overload Capacity: Ten times rated current
Reset Time: 5 to 30 seconds
